So does Valerian root work? Is it dangerous?

I used to take valerian root along with melatonin to try and help me sleep. It kinda smells bad but it had no side effects for me. Didn't really help with sleep either though. Sorry if this doesn't help. I don't think it's dangerous.

I used to take it to calm down and it was mildly effective. Don't take it however, if you're on psych meds as there can be an interaction.
